Lines Matching refs:mutex
61 std::unique_lock<std::mutex> lock(mCore->mMutex); in acquireBuffer()
290 std::lock_guard<std::mutex> lock(mCore->mMutex); in detachBuffer()
334 std::lock_guard<std::mutex> lock(mCore->mMutex); in attachBuffer()
426 std::lock_guard<std::mutex> lock(mCore->mMutex); in releaseBuffer()
491 std::lock_guard<std::mutex> lock(mCore->mMutex); in connect()
509 std::lock_guard<std::mutex> lock(mCore->mMutex); in disconnect()
533 std::lock_guard<std::mutex> lock(mCore->mMutex); in getReleasedBuffers()
575 std::lock_guard<std::mutex> lock(mCore->mMutex); in setDefaultBufferSize()
589 std::lock_guard<std::mutex> lock(mCore->mMutex); in setMaxBufferCount()
629 std::unique_lock<std::mutex> lock(mCore->mMutex); in setMaxAcquiredBufferCount()
690 std::lock_guard<std::mutex> lock(mCore->mMutex); in setConsumerName()
699 std::lock_guard<std::mutex> lock(mCore->mMutex); in setDefaultBufferFormat()
708 std::lock_guard<std::mutex> lock(mCore->mMutex); in setDefaultBufferDataSpace()
716 std::lock_guard<std::mutex> lock(mCore->mMutex); in setConsumerUsageBits()
724 std::lock_guard<std::mutex> lock(mCore->mMutex); in setConsumerIsProtected()
732 std::lock_guard<std::mutex> lock(mCore->mMutex); in setTransformHint()
738 std::lock_guard<std::mutex> lock(mCore->mMutex); in getSidebandStream()
745 std::lock_guard<std::mutex> lock(mCore->mMutex); in getOccupancyHistory()
751 std::lock_guard<std::mutex> lock(mCore->mMutex); in discardFreeBuffers()